Indraprastha International School in Sector 10, Dwarka is a senior secondary CBSE affiliated school. CBSE records list its affiliation number as 2730459 and confirm its affiliation period from April 2025 to March 2030.
Its location and senior secondary offering make it another school that parents may consider when comparing options for older students.
Vishwa Bharati Public School is situated in Sector 6, Dwarka and is affiliated with CBSE at the senior secondary level. Official CBSE records list affiliation number 2730414.
Its long presence in the area makes it another established option for families researching schools in Dwarka.
A CBSE affiliation confirms that a school follows the board’s prescribed academic framework, but it does not mean every school provides the same day to day experience.
Parents should look at the complete picture.
Strong teaching is the foundation of a good school. Look for teachers who encourage understanding, questioning and practical application instead of relying only on memorisation.
A school campus should support different types of learning. Science laboratories, computer facilities, libraries, activity rooms, sports areas and well equipped classrooms can add value to a student’s education.
Education extends beyond textbooks. Sports, music, art, theatre, debates, clubs and competitions can help children build communication skills, confidence and teamwork.
Safety should always be a priority. Parents can ask about campus security, transportation, emergency procedures, medical facilities and systems for communicating with parents.
Parents often search specifically for the Best CBSE schools in Dwarka for board results. Academic performance is certainly an important factor, particularly for students approaching Classes 10 and 12.
However, board results should be viewed alongside teaching quality and the overall learning environment. A school that supports students consistently throughout the academic year can be more valuable than one chosen only because of a particular year’s result.
Parents should also ask about subject choices, academic support, career counselling, examination preparation and guidance for higher education.

A practical way to compare schools is to create a shortlist of three or four institutions and visit each campus.
Consider these points:
• Distance from home
• CBSE affiliation and classes offered
• Academic approach
• Teacher experience
• Classroom environment
• Laboratories and library
• Sports and activity facilities
• Safety arrangements
• Transport facilities
• Fee structure
• Admission criteria
• Student support and counselling
It is also worth speaking with the admission team and asking questions about a normal school day. This can give parents a better understanding of what the child’s actual experience may be.
